Output 16c58e132fade4ff26e6afe7a334338595de1df8ff08097e47393ad6c94e47c6:0

value
8657240
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ae634333eabfc2ec6d1dc6691dcf5ed670156cb7 OP_EQUAL
address
3Hb6QoVavLEzFobKj8xFFGMvrXbS7WJ5tA
transaction
16c58e132fade4ff26e6afe7a334338595de1df8ff08097e47393ad6c94e47c6
spent
true